Goldman Sachs Summer Analyst Offer
The Goldman Sachs Summer Analyst offer is a highly sought-after opportunity for students and young professionals to gain hands-on experience in the financial industry. As one of the most prestigious investment banks in the world, Goldman Sachs provides a unique platform for individuals to develop their skills, network, and knowledge in the field. The Summer Analyst program is a 10-week internship that takes place during the summer months, typically from June to August, and is designed to provide participants with a comprehensive introduction to the firm's businesses and functions.
Overview of the Summer Analyst Program
The Summer Analyst program at Goldman Sachs is a rigorous and competitive program that attracts top talent from around the world. The program is designed to provide participants with a broad range of experiences, including project work, training sessions, and networking opportunities. Summer Analysts are assigned to a specific division within the firm, such as Investment Banking, Asset Management, or Securities, and work closely with full-time professionals to contribute to ongoing projects and initiatives. The program also includes a comprehensive training program, which covers topics such as financial modeling, valuation techniques, and industry trends.
Application and Selection Process
The application and selection process for the Goldman Sachs Summer Analyst program is highly competitive and involves several stages. The process typically begins with an online application, which includes submitting a resume, cover letter, and transcripts. Selected candidates are then invited to participate in a series of phone or video interviews, which are used to assess their skills, experience, and fit with the firm’s culture. The final stage of the selection process involves an in-person interview at one of Goldman Sachs’ offices, where candidates meet with representatives from the division they are applying to. The selection process typically takes several months to complete, and successful candidates are notified of their offer in the winter or early spring.

Career Opportunities
The Goldman Sachs Summer Analyst program is a great way to launch a career in finance, and many participants are offered full-time positions at the firm after completing the program. In fact, over 90% of Summer Analysts are offered full-time positions, which is a testament to the firm’s commitment to developing and retaining top talent. The skills and experience gained during the Summer Analyst program are highly transferable, and many participants go on to pursue careers in investment banking, asset management, and other areas of the financial industry.

How long does the Summer Analyst program last?
+The Goldman Sachs Summer Analyst program typically lasts for 10 weeks, from June to August. However, the exact duration of the program may vary depending on the division and location.
What kind of support and resources are available to Summer Analysts?
+Goldman Sachs provides a range of support and resources to Summer Analysts, including training programs, mentoring, and career counseling. Summer Analysts are also assigned a buddy or mentor who can provide guidance and support throughout the program.
